หากความเร็วสูงสุด USB 2.0 คือ 35MBp / s (480 mbits) ทำไมฉันจึงถ่ายโอนที่ 120MB ผ่านกิกะบิต?


1

ฉันมี HDD ภายนอก USB 2.0 และเมื่อฉันถ่ายโอนบางสิ่งไปยัง / จาก HDD ผ่านเครือข่ายกิกะบิตฉันมีความเร็วในการถ่ายโอน 120MB แต่ USB 2.0 รองรับ 35MB


1
ระบบปฏิบัติการมักจะแคชข้อมูลใน RAM ก่อนที่จะเขียนลงในดิสก์ นี่อาจทำให้สิ่งที่คุณเขียนมีความเร็วสูง
magicandre1981

สิ่งที่เกิดขึ้นคืออัตราการถ่ายโอนที่คุณกำลังอ่านไม่ใช่สิ่งที่ถ่ายโอนจริง ๆ แล้วมันเป็นอัตราสูงสุดที่สามารถถ่ายโอนได้ทั้งหมด ไดรฟ์ของคุณไม่รองรับ 120MB / s ดังนั้นจึงถ่ายโอนได้เพียง 35MB / s เท่านั้น แต่หากอุปกรณ์สามารถถ่ายโอน 120M / s ได้ มันเหมือนกับว่าคอมพิวเตอร์ของฉันสามารถเชื่อมต่ออินเทอร์เน็ตได้ 100MB / s แต่โมเด็มของฉันรองรับ 25MB / s เท่านั้นดังนั้นฉันจึงได้ 25MB / s เท่านั้น
Ben Franchuk

ไม่ @BenFranchuk ถ้ามันบอกว่ามันถ่ายโอนที่ 120MB มันทำเช่นนั้นจริง ๆ ฉันเห็นด้วยกับ magicandre1981 แคชจนกว่าจะสามารถเขียนลงดิสก์ได้
PsychoData

@PsychoData แคชไม่ใช่อนันต์ดังนั้น Joe เพียงแค่ต้องการถ่ายโอนอีกต่อไปเพื่อดูว่าประสิทธิภาพลดลงหรือไม่
พอล

1
@Joe: จากความอยากรู้คุณเห็นการแสดงนี้ที่ไหน คุณพูดถึงการถ่ายโอนบางอย่างผ่านเครือข่าย Gigabit แต่แล้วพูดถึงขีด จำกัด ของ USB 2.0 ที่ 35mb / s ฉันสับสนเล็กน้อยเกี่ยวกับห่วงโซ่ของเหตุการณ์ที่แน่นอน ... เครือข่าย Gigabit เข้ามาเล่นที่ไหน?
jrista
โ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.